Hattiesburg to Huntsville

Updated: 28 May 2026

The drive from Hattiesburg to Huntsville takes about 5 hours and covers 450 kilometers. You will travel north on I-59 to Birmingham, then north on I-65 into Huntsville. This route takes you through the heart of Mississippi and Alabama. It is a straightforward drive on major interstate highways. Huntsville is known for its space history, museums, and cultural attractions.

Total Distance: 450 km driving distance; 400 km straight-line air distance.

Things to Do in Huntsville
1
U.S. Space & Rocket Center
A world-class museum featuring space exploration exhibits and rockets.
2
Huntsville Botanical Garden
A beautiful garden with seasonal displays and walking trails.
3
Monte Sano State Park
Offers hiking, camping, and scenic views of the city.
4
Downtown Huntsville
Features local shops, restaurants, and cultural attractions.
